intoxicated

BrE /ɪnˈtɒksɪkeɪtɪd/ AmE /ˌɪntɑːkˈsɪkeɪtɪd/

adjective en → es

1 DRUNK [predicative] B2

affected by alcohol; drunk

intoxicado, borracho, ebrio

  • be intoxicated

Collocations intoxicated with alcohol · become intoxicated

  • He was so intoxicated that he couldn't walk straight.

    Estaba tan intoxicado que no podía caminar recto.

2 ADDICTED [predicative] C1

affected by a drug; addicted to drugs

intoxicado, drogado, adicto

  • be intoxicated with drugs

Collocations intoxicated by drugs · become intoxicated on drugs

  • She was found unconscious and heavily intoxicated.

    Se encontró inconsciente y fuertemente intoxicada.

3 STIMULATED [predicative] C1

affected by a drug; stimulated or excited by a drug

estimulado, excitado, animado

  • be intoxicated with something

Collocations intoxicated by the thrill of victory · become intoxicated on excitement

  • He was intoxicated by the rush of adrenaline.

    Estaba intoxicado por la emoción del adrenalinazo.
